PLDT Inc. mobile unit Smart Communications has begun a major network expansion in Metro Manila to improve the coverage and quality of its voice, SMS and mobile internet services, particularly 4G LTE. Local press in the Philippines cite the cellco’s chief technology and information advisor Joachim Horn as saying that the three-month project will significantly boost the reach of Smart’s LTE and 3G mobile data services across all 17 of the cities and municipalities of Metro Manila. Under the works, the operator will improve indoor coverage for both 3G and 4G signals, he said, given that as he points out: ‘people use mobile internet services mostly indoors, particularly in Metro Manila – in their homes, offices, restaurants, coffee shops, and the like’. In total, some 2,500 new cell sites will be deployed across Metro Manila using lower frequency bands – e.g. 700MHz, 850MHz and 900MHz – to provide the widest coverage possible in terms of indoor signals. In addition, 1800MHz and 2100MHz capacity is also being increased.
The Metro Manila works form part of a wider three-year network expansion that kicked off in Boracay and Metro Davao in the early part of 2016, and which has since been extended to Metro Cebu, where upgrade works are ongoing. Going hand in glove with the rollout, Smart is in talks with handset makers to usher in more affordable smartphones while longer term, it intends to make LTE progressively available to users in 1,551 cities and municipalities across the Philippines by end-2018.
